KUALA LUMPUR: Former minister at the Prime Minister's Department Datuk Seri Jamil Khir Baharom was charged at the Sessions Court here with three counts of causing Lembaga Tabung Haji (TH) to dispose of more than RM860.3 million in assets belonging to the institution between 2015 and 2017.
The Jerai MP pleaded not guilty after the charges were read out before Sessions Court judge Rosli Ahmad here on Monday (Sept 15).
